Thursday 1 May 2025
Following the success of the pilot SevisPass launch in 2024, Secretary for the Department of Information and Communications Technology (DICT) Mr Steven Matainaho has announced that the Department will now commence a nationwide data integration exercise to support “Papua New Guinea’s first-ever functional Digital ID.”
The Digital ID system will help citizens access public and private sector services more easily and securely.
Secretary Matainaho explained that the integration exercise will bring together key partners, including the Civil Registry Office, banks, telecommunication companies, superannuation funds, and other important sectors.
According to DICT Secretary this exercise will bring together government agencies (including Civil Registry Office), financial institutions, telecommunication operators, superannuation funds, and other key sectors to:
✅ Enable secure, consent-based eKYC verification for both public and private sector services
✅ Streamline access to banking, SIM registration, and government services
✅ Introduce Single Sign-On (SSO) across government digital systems
✅ Support biometric identity verification for the 2027 National General Elections.
The national integration process will involve mapping out sources of personal data, ensuring secure and consent-based data sharing, connecting agencies through secure systems, and testing everything for safety and efficiency. It will also include accrediting Digital ID providers who will issue the SevisPass credentials.
“This initiative is guided by the Digital Transformation Policy 2020, the Data Governance and Protection Policy 2024, and the forthcoming Digital ID Policy 2025,” he added.
As part of this rollout, DICT will host national workshops and information sessions during May and June. These events aim to help all data holders and stakeholders understand how the Digital ID system will work, the policies behind it, and how it will benefit both citizens and businesses.
